Output 095fbb72a32e636c54bd17ce511f09f03bead74a67731fb58ea121d118dd9576:35

value
343756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61c17064250f904e780534c5c39f66ad7c14f434 OP_EQUAL
address
3AbuCXjCRYXv5uwBTbsQ3B11C9ZhkeTJkt
transaction
095fbb72a32e636c54bd17ce511f09f03bead74a67731fb58ea121d118dd9576
confirmations
135413
spent
true